#f63202 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f63202 is composed of 96.5% red, 19.6%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 79.7% magenta, 99.2%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 11.8 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 48.6%. #f63202 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6404 with #ed0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3300.

#f63202 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f63202 has RGB values of R:246, G:50,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.8, Y:0.99,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16134658.
